Abstract

The utility model provides an automatic abluent intelligent toilet bowl includes frame, wiper mechanism, toilet seat base and ring base at least, and the wiper mechanism sets up in the frame. The pedestal pan base is connected with a first driving mechanism, and the first driving mechanism can drive the pedestal pan base to enter the rack or the rack. The seat base is connected with a second driving mechanism, and the second driving mechanism can drive the seat base to enter the rack or move out of the rack. The seat ring base is positioned above the pedestal pan base. The frame is provided with an opening through which the pedestal pan base and the seat ring base can pass. The pedestal pan base is used for installing a pedestal pan, and the seat ring base is used for installing a seat ring. The pedestal pan base and the seat ring base can respectively drive the pedestal pan and the seat ring to enter the rack, and the pedestal pan and the seat ring are cleaned by the cleaning mechanism, so that the function of fully automatically cleaning the pedestal pan and the seat ring is realized.

Background
The intelligent public toilet is a new technical field, and the whole public toilet is required to realize intellectualization without people. The traditional public toilet can not be cleaned frequently, and the smell is unpleasant, so that one requirement of the intelligent public toilet is that the toilet can be cleaned automatically. In the prior art, various semi-intelligent toilet cleaning devices are provided, but most of the devices need to be manually pushed to be used, so that the prior art is mostly semi-automatic. In view of this, a new technical solution needs to be provided to realize full automation of public toilet cleaning.

A preferred embodiment of the intelligent toilet bowl with automatic cleaning function is shown in fig. 1 and 2, and comprises a cleaning mechanism, a frame 100, a toilet seat base 10 and a seat base 301, wherein the toilet bowl 20 is installed on the seat base 301, the seat 30 is installed on the seat base 301, the seat base 301 is located above the toilet seat base 10, and the seat 30 can be placed on the toilet bowl 20 after being put down. The specific shapes and structures of the toilet 20 and the seat 30 can be selected according to the needs, and are not described herein. The toilet base 10 is connected with a first driving mechanism 11, and the first driving mechanism 11 can drive the toilet base 10 to move, so that the toilet base 10 and the toilet 20 can enter or move out of the frame 100. Similarly, a second driving mechanism 31 is connected to the seat base 301, and the second driving mechanism 31 can also drive the seat base 301 to move into or out of the rack 100. The washing mechanism is disposed inside the frame 100, and the washing mechanism is used for washing the seat 30 and the toilet bowl 20. The seat base 301 and the toilet base 10 may be moved into the frame together, and the seat 30 and the toilet 20 are cleaned by the cleaning mechanism at the same time, or the seat base 301 and the toilet base 10 may be moved into the frame respectively, and the seat 30 or the toilet 20 is cleaned by the cleaning mechanism alone. As shown in fig. 7, the frame 100 is provided with an opening 106, the frame 100 is further provided with a baffle 1005 (for convenience of illustrating the internal structure of the frame 100, only a part of the baffle is illustrated in fig. 7, but not illustrating the specific structure of the baffle), and the baffle 1005 can cover the opening to prevent the sewage from splashing. The inner wall of the frame 100 is provided with a baffle slide 1004, and the baffle slide 1004 is used for providing motion guidance for the baffle.
The concrete structure of toilet seat base 10 and first actuating mechanism 11 is as shown in fig. 3 and 4 toilet seat base 10 is last to be provided with along the toilet seat riser 13 of vertical direction, toilet seat 20 can be installed on toilet seat riser 13. The toilet mounting riser 13 is provided with water pipe holes, specifically, the water pipe holes comprise a flushing pipe hole 131 and a drain pipe hole 132 for adapting the flushing pipe 51 and the drain pipe 52 of the toilet 20, wherein the flushing pipe 51 is connected with the water tank 61, and the drain pipe 52 is connected with a sewer. In view of the movable toilet 20, the flush pipe 51 and the drain pipe 52 are flexible pipes capable of bending freely, preventing the pipes from interfering with the normal movement of the toilet 20. In the scheme, the flushing pipe 51 and the drain pipe 52 are both connected to the vertical surface behind the pedestal pan 20, so that the function of reducing the interference of the water pipe on the normal movement of the pedestal pan base 10 is achieved.
The bottom of the pedestal pan base 10 is provided with a plurality of pulleys 14, so that the movement stability of the pedestal pan base 10 is improved. The both sides of toilet seat base 10 still are provided with first slider 12 respectively, correspond be provided with on the frame 100 inner wall with the first slide 1001 of first slider 12 adaptation, first slide 1001 can guide first slider 12 slides, increases toilet seat base 10's motion stationarity, provides the motion direction for toilet seat base 10 simultaneously, guarantees that toilet seat base 10 can follow predetermined route back and forth movement. In order to facilitate the installation of the first sliding block 12, a connecting rod 120 is fixedly connected to the toilet base 10, and the first sliding block 12 is installed at both ends of the connecting rod 120.
As shown in fig. 5, similar to the structure of the toilet seat 10, the second sliding blocks 32 are installed on two sides of the seat base 301, and the inner wall of the frame 100 is provided with the second sliding rails 1002 adapted to the second sliding blocks 32, so that the functions of guiding the seat base 301 and improving the movement stability of the seat base 301 can be achieved.
The first driving mechanism 11 and the second driving mechanism 31 may be a push rod mechanism as shown in the figure, but may also be an electric screw mechanism or other common power mechanisms, and are not limited herein.
As shown in fig. 6, the cleaning mechanism includes a brushing mechanism and a rinsing mechanism. The brush mechanism includes a cleaning brush 102 and a cleaning brush drive that drives the cleaning brush 102 in rotation, which may be a rotary motor 1021, or other similar mechanism that is rotatable. The washing brush 102 brushes the inner surface of the toilet bowl 20 while rotating. The flushing mechanism comprises a plurality of nozzles 103, the nozzles 103 are connected with the cleaning water tank 62, and the nozzles 103 can spray liquid supplied by the cleaning water tank 103, such as cleaning liquid or clean water, so as to flush the toilet bowl 20 and the toilet seat 30. In the scheme, considering that stubborn dirt possibly remains on the inner wall of the toilet bowl 20, the cleaning brush 102 can be used for cleaning, and then the cleaning head 103 is used for cleaning; the seat ring 30 generally has no dirt which is too hard, and can be washed clean by directly using the spray head 103.
In order to prevent sewage from splashing upwards to affect the normal operation of each component, the cleaning mechanism further comprises a cleaning outer cover 101, the cleaning outer cover 101 is connected with a vertical driving mechanism 1011, and the vertical driving mechanism 1011 is fixedly connected with the rack 100. The flushing mechanism and the scrubbing mechanism are both disposed on the cleaning housing 101. The cleaning cover 101 can cover the toilet bowl 20 below after descending, and prevent sewage from flying upwards. When the cleaning cover 101 is lowered, the cleaning brush 102 can be also driven to be lowered, so the cleaning brush 102 can be designed to be correspondingly shorter as long as the cleaning brush 102 can be ensured to contact the toilet bowl 20 after the cleaning cover 101 is lowered. Because the cleaning outer cover 101 can also move up and down, a third slide block 105 is arranged on the outer wall surface of the cleaning outer cover 101, a third slide way 1003 is arranged on the inner wall of the rack 100 along the vertical direction, and the third slide block 105 is matched with the third slide way 1003. The third slide block 105 slides along the third slide way 1003 all the time, so that the cleaning outer cover 101 can move stably.
Furthermore, the drying device 104 and the germicidal lamp 4 are fixedly disposed on the inner wall of the housing 100. The drying device 104 may be a device capable of blowing air to dry the residual liquid on the toilet bowl 20 or the seat 30; or the drying device 104 may be a device capable of generating heat to dry the liquid; other conventional devices capable of drying are also possible. The sterilizing lamp 4 can be started after the washing is finished, so that the toilet stool 20 and the toilet seat 30 are sterilized, and the cleaning effect is further improved.
